The Minnesota Vikings‘ 2026 regular season schedule dropped on Thursday night, and there’s reason to be excited.

The schedule features 4 primetime spots for the Vikings.

Not only that, but the Vikings’ season starts off with a bang. Their first 2 games are NFC North matchups, beginning at home against Green Bay and on the road in Chicago. Another main advantage held by Minnesota is the 5 of the final 7 games that take place on home turf.

In even more positive news, it is a very advantageous schedule for kicker Will Reichard.

Vikings’ Schedule is a ‘Dream’ for Will Reichard

Adam Fromal of TheVikingAge recently put together a compelling piece regarding the Vikings’ schedule and what it means for Will Reichard.

…I was able to use the aforementioned factors to give every single game on the NFL calendar a composite weather score, ranging from pristine dome conditions to the brutal Week 15 primetime matchup between the Chicago Bears and Buffalo Bills at Highmark Stadium.

Minnesota’s report card looks, in a word, incredible:

  • Week 1: A conditions vs. Green Bay Packers (dome)
  • Week 2: B- conditions @ Chicago Bears
  • Week 3: A- conditions @ Tampa Bay Buccaneers
  • Week 4: A conditions vs. Miami Dolphins (dome)
  • Week 5: A conditions @ New Orleans Saints (dome)
  • Week 7: A conditions vs. Indianapolis Colts (dome)
  • Week 8: A conditions @ Detroit Lions (dome)
  • Week 9: A conditions vs. Buffalo Bills (dome)
  • Week 10: C- conditions @ Green Bay Packers
  • Week 11: A- conditions @ San Francisco 49ers
  • Week 12: A conditions vs. Atlanta Falcons (dome)
  • Week 13: A conditions vs. Carolina Panthers (dome)
  • Week 14: C- conditions @ New England Patriots
  • Week 15: A conditions vs. Detroit Lions (dome)
  • Week 16: A conditions vs. Washington Commanders (dome)
  • Week 17: C conditions @ New York Jets
  • Week 18: A conditions vs. Chicago Bears (dome)“.

2026 could be a major year for “Will The Thrill”.

Minnesota Staying Home for Most of Back-Half of 2026 Season

Like the third-consecutive Week 6 bye-week, Jonathan Harrison of Sports Illustrated pointed out the Vikings’ advantageous final 7-game stretch.

Minnesota will finish the season with five of their last seven games at U.S. Bank Stadium.

The pair of two-game homestands will be split by the Week 14 Thursday Night Football game against the Patriots. That means Minnesota will have five weeks starting with two home games, followed by a quick trip out to New England, a 10-day mini-bye week, and then another pair of home games that kick off the final four games of the season.

The Vikings will host the Falcons, Panthers, Lions, and Commanders during the four games in that stretch. Those are four games the Vikings, especially since they are hosting, should be competitive and potentially even favored in. Minnesota will then close out the regular season with a final road game at New York, taking on a Jets team likely to already be eliminated from playoff contention, and then a home finale against the Bears.”

This is a very welcome revelation for a Minnesota Vikings team trying to return to the postseason. Minnesota will likely be tested on the road in New England, but all indications towards it being quite advantageous for one the two road games in the final seven weeks to be against the Jets.

You can’t ask for much more help when it comes to home-field advantage during your playoff push.
